#ifndef REFERENCEOBJECTBUFFERSTANDARD_HPP_
#define REFERENCEOBJECTBUFFERSTANDARD_HPP_
#include "j9.h"
#include "j9cfg.h"
#include "ReferenceObjectBuffer.hpp"
/**
* A per-thread buffer of recently allocated reference objects.
* The buffer is periodically flushed to the global list.
*/
class MM_ReferenceObjectBufferStandard : public MM_ReferenceObjectBuffer
{
private:
uintptr_t _referenceObjectListIndex; /**< List index to dump buffer to. This is a cyclic index fro 0->listsize-1 */
protected:
public:
private:
protected:
virtual bool initialize(MM_EnvironmentBase *env);
virtual void tearDown(MM_EnvironmentBase *env);
/**
* Flush the contents of the buffer to the appropriate global buffers.
* Subclasses must override.
* @param env[in] the current thread
*/
virtual void flushImpl(MM_EnvironmentBase *env);
public:
static MM_ReferenceObjectBufferStandard *newInstance(MM_EnvironmentBase *env);
/**
* Construct a new buffer.
* @param maxObjectCount the maximum number of objects permitted before a forced flush
*/
MM_ReferenceObjectBufferStandard(uintptr_t maxObjectCount);
#if defined(J9VM_OPT_CRIU_SUPPORT)
/**
* Reinitialize the buffer's _maxObjectCount to account for the new restore GC thread count.
* _maxObjectCount was initially set based on the GC thread count at VM startup.
*
* @param[in] env the current environment.
* @return boolean indicating whether the buffer was successfully reinitialized.
*/
virtual bool reinitializeForRestore(MM_EnvironmentBase *env);
#endif /* defined(J9VM_OPT_CRIU_SUPPORT) */
};
#endif /* REFERENCEOBJECTBUFFERSTANDARD_HPP_ */
